#ocl — Public Fediverse posts
Live and recent posts from across the Fediverse tagged #ocl, aggregated by home.social.
-
@stargirl has simplified the Open Community License (OCL) from Prusa
➡️ https://github.com/theacodes/socl#3dprinting #prusa #ocl #socl #OpenSource #copyright #openwashing #opensourcewashing
-
We keep improving our #OCL #parser and #evaluator, e.g. https://github.com/BESSER-PEARL/BESSER/issues/367#event-21642067463
Keep reporting your issues!
-
🚨MAJOR RELEASE ALERT 🚨
Today we are launching BESSER v.4, with some massive improvements 👏🥳🎉:
✅ Project management: create new #modeling projects comprising different types of diagrams (#classdiagram, #statemachine, #objectdiagram...) in our #online #modeling #editor
✅Create object diagrams to model specific scenarios conforming to your class diagram
✅ #Evaluate #ocl constraints on your object diagram and get #feedback on whether your scenarios are #valid
✅ Plus many other improvements: #fluentapi, #rdf generation,...
📜https://github.com/BESSER-PEARL/BESSER/releases
⚙️https://github.com/BESSER-PEARL/BESSERI can feel your #FOMO so don't wait any longer. Give it a try NOW ➡️ https://editor.besser-pearl.org/
Pls also reshare this post and drop a ⭐ on #github so that others can also benefit from our #opensource #lowcode #free #platform
#uml #ocl #classdiagram #database #sql #codegenerator #vibemodeling -
🚨MAJOR RELEASE ALERT 🚨
Today we are launching BESSER v.4, with some massive improvements 👏🥳🎉:
✅ Project management: create new #modeling projects comprising different types of diagrams (#classdiagram, #statemachine, #objectdiagram...) in our #online #modeling #editor
✅Create object diagrams to model specific scenarios conforming to your class diagram
✅ #Evaluate #ocl constraints on your object diagram and get #feedback on whether your scenarios are #valid
✅ Plus many other improvements: #fluentapi, #rdf generation,...
📜https://github.com/BESSER-PEARL/BESSER/releases
⚙️https://github.com/BESSER-PEARL/BESSERI can feel your #FOMO so don't wait any longer. Give it a try NOW ➡️ https://editor.besser-pearl.org/
Pls also reshare this post and drop a ⭐ on #github so that others can also benefit from our #opensource #lowcode #free #platform
#uml #ocl #classdiagram #database #sql #codegenerator #vibemodeling -
🚨MAJOR RELEASE ALERT 🚨
Today we are launching BESSER v.4, with some massive improvements 👏🥳🎉:
✅ Project management: create new #modeling projects comprising different types of diagrams (#classdiagram, #statemachine, #objectdiagram...) in our #online #modeling #editor
✅Create object diagrams to model specific scenarios conforming to your class diagram
✅ #Evaluate #ocl constraints on your object diagram and get #feedback on whether your scenarios are #valid
✅ Plus many other improvements: #fluentapi, #rdf generation,...
📜https://github.com/BESSER-PEARL/BESSER/releases
⚙️https://github.com/BESSER-PEARL/BESSERI can feel your #FOMO so don't wait any longer. Give it a try NOW ➡️ https://editor.besser-pearl.org/
Pls also reshare this post and drop a ⭐ on #github so that others can also benefit from our #opensource #lowcode #free #platform
#uml #ocl #classdiagram #database #sql #codegenerator #vibemodeling -
🚨MAJOR RELEASE ALERT 🚨
Today we are launching BESSER v.4, with some massive improvements 👏🥳🎉:
✅ Project management: create new #modeling projects comprising different types of diagrams (#classdiagram, #statemachine, #objectdiagram...) in our #online #modeling #editor
✅Create object diagrams to model specific scenarios conforming to your class diagram
✅ #Evaluate #ocl constraints on your object diagram and get #feedback on whether your scenarios are #valid
✅ Plus many other improvements: #fluentapi, #rdf generation,...
📜https://github.com/BESSER-PEARL/BESSER/releases
⚙️https://github.com/BESSER-PEARL/BESSERI can feel your #FOMO so don't wait any longer. Give it a try NOW ➡️ https://editor.besser-pearl.org/
Pls also reshare this post and drop a ⭐ on #github so that others can also benefit from our #opensource #lowcode #free #platform
#uml #ocl #classdiagram #database #sql #codegenerator #vibemodeling -
🆕New releases of the #lowcode and #uml #tools #dashboards 📊
✅ Low-code dashboard
See all #opensource low-code tools and stats on which are the most active ones, how many are also #nocode, use #AI, rely on #modeling...
🔗https://github.com/jcabot/oss-lowcode-tools
📈 Live: https://oss-lowcode-tools.streamlit.app/
✅ UML dashboard
See all #oss #uml tools and stats on which are the most popular ones, how many are use #OCL, are extensions of #PlantUML...
-
✊🏽actu militante✊ La Révolution Prolétarienne a 100 ans !: « La revue qui n'a pas observé le mouvement ouvrier, mais qui l'a vécu » - CA 349 avril 2025 / Leur Histoire, Notre Mémoire , Lutte de classes -- CA 349 avril 2025 , Leur… #RévolutionProlétarienne #MouvementOuvrier #OCL #Histoire #Mémoire
La Révolution Prolétarienne a ... -
I was manually looking for #OCL #courses (via a classical Google search, yes, some of us still do it from time to time) to complement the info we got from our hashtag#teaching #ocl online form ⬇️
📋https://modeling-languages.com/teaching-ocl/ You still have the time to fill it! ✍️
And my overall impression is that:
❌ Very few institutions teach OCL.
❌ Even worse, I feel there are less and less. Indeed, when searching online, I get quite a lot of old results from courses that were offered at some point (many around 15-20 years ago) but have since then disappeared (I guess replaced by, among others, sexier AI related topics).
❌ The tooling situation is one of the key factors (as reported also in the comments of the post linked above).
✅ I'm hoping that our online OCL tool (see https://github.com/BESSER-PEARL/B-OCL-Interpreter, led by Fitash Ul Haq, PhD and now part of our #web #modeling #editor https://editor.besser-pearl.org/ ) and free #tutorials can be useful if any of you wants to give OCL a second chance.Because if not OCL, then what? 🤔
-
Model class diagrams and generate code from your web-browser. No need to install anything.
🔗 Try it out: https://editor.besser-pearl.org/
Some key features:
✅#Graphical modelling: Design models with an intuitive graphical notation.
✅Cloud Storage: #Store your diagrams online for easy access from anywhere
✅Real-time #collaboration: Work seamlessly with multiple users on the same model.
✅#CodeGeneration: Automatically generate code for various technologies (e.g., databases).
✅#OCL Integration: Define OCL constraints with of our B-OCL tool
✅#Supports model import/export in B-UML and #JSON formatshttps://modeling-languages.com/besser-graphical-modeling-editor/
-
Learn more about #OCL support in BESSER and how you can add constraints to your class diagrams. Even as part of our web modeling editor (with the option to #check their syntactic correctness) 🤯🤯
📜 https://arxiv.org/abs/2503.00944
⚙️https://github.com/BESSER-PEARL/B-OCL-Interpreter -
We did a software experiment today 👨🔬🧪⚗️
I gathered 11 people to test during 2h our #lowcode platform BESSER as part of a #user #study.
During these 2h they had to "play" with the tool. They could #test any aspect of the tool (the #code generators, the web modeling #editor , the #OCL interpreter,...) and report all the issues (bugs but also feaures they felt were missing).
This was also a way to make sure everybody gained some experience with the tooling as some were only familiar with specific components.
I'm very happy with the result. We all learned a lot about what people expected from the tool. And as a result, we opened #70 new #issues 👏👏👏
Our next 🧪⚗️ will be to see how many of these 70 can be automatically fixed with an #AI #assistant 🤔. We'll first a triaging of those that are #goodfirstissues and start with those.
Later, we'll repeat the experience with the BESSER Agentic Framework
And, honestly, if you're developing a tool, try it with yours. I really think it's one of the actions with better #ROI you could do
Thanks to Adem Ait Fonollà Marcos Gomez Mengxi He Jonathan Silva Mercado Fitash Ul Haq, PhD atefeh nirumand Faima Abbasi Gwendal JOUNEAUX
and Armen Sulejmani and Iván Alfonso for animating the session
-
Create #models and #OCL constraints on your web browser. #Validate them and generate a full #django application from them (or #SQL or an #API or #Python classes or... ) and deploy them with #dockercompose.
What else could you wish for??
https://besser.readthedocs.io/en/latest/releases/v2/v2.2.0.html
-
🍾🍾There's a new #OCL interpreter in town!🍾🍾
With it, you'll be able to evaluate OCL expressions over a system snapshot 🤯🤯
📖 https://modeling-languages.com/ocl-interpreter/
⚙️ https://github.com/BESSER-PEARL/BOCL-Interpreter#uml #lowcode #validation #verification #object #constraint #language
-
BESSER version 1 released – You can start “playing” with our #opensource #lowcode tool ! https://buff.ly/3Ty7pJ1
With #ocl support, #objectdiagrams #ui #restpi generation...
-
World Ocean Atlas 2023 - Global Climatologies of Temperature, Salinity, Dissolved Oxygen, and Inorganic Nutrients
--
https://www.ncei.noaa.gov/news/World-Ocean-Atlas-2023-v2 <-- shared technical article
--
#GIS #spatial #mapping #NOAA #NCEI #water #hydrology #hydrography #OceanClimateLaboratory #OCL #WorldOceanAtlas #WOA #WOA23 #global #world #temperature #salinity #dissolvedoxygen #inorganicnutrients #inorganic #nutrients #WorldOceanDatabase #WOD #opendata #opendatagateway #oceangraphy #climatologies #climate #depth #sampling #remotesensing #hydrospatial #Nitrate #Phosphate #Silicate #statistics #geostatistics
@NOAA @NOAA_NCEI -
World Ocean Atlas 2023 - Global Climatologies of Temperature, Salinity, Dissolved Oxygen, and Inorganic Nutrients
--
https://www.ncei.noaa.gov/news/World-Ocean-Atlas-2023-v2 <-- shared technical article
--
#GIS #spatial #mapping #NOAA #NCEI #water #hydrology #hydrography #OceanClimateLaboratory #OCL #WorldOceanAtlas #WOA #WOA23 #global #world #temperature #salinity #dissolvedoxygen #inorganicnutrients #inorganic #nutrients #WorldOceanDatabase #WOD #opendata #opendatagateway #oceangraphy #climatologies #climate #depth #sampling #remotesensing #hydrospatial #Nitrate #Phosphate #Silicate #statistics #geostatistics
@NOAA @NOAA_NCEI -
World Ocean Atlas 2023 - Global Climatologies of Temperature, Salinity, Dissolved Oxygen, and Inorganic Nutrients
--
https://www.ncei.noaa.gov/news/World-Ocean-Atlas-2023-v2 <-- shared technical article
--
#GIS #spatial #mapping #NOAA #NCEI #water #hydrology #hydrography #OceanClimateLaboratory #OCL #WorldOceanAtlas #WOA #WOA23 #global #world #temperature #salinity #dissolvedoxygen #inorganicnutrients #inorganic #nutrients #WorldOceanDatabase #WOD #opendata #opendatagateway #oceangraphy #climatologies #climate #depth #sampling #remotesensing #hydrospatial #Nitrate #Phosphate #Silicate #statistics #geostatistics
@NOAA @NOAA_NCEI -
World Ocean Atlas 2023 - Global Climatologies of Temperature, Salinity, Dissolved Oxygen, and Inorganic Nutrients
--
https://www.ncei.noaa.gov/news/World-Ocean-Atlas-2023-v2 <-- shared technical article
--
#GIS #spatial #mapping #NOAA #NCEI #water #hydrology #hydrography #OceanClimateLaboratory #OCL #WorldOceanAtlas #WOA #WOA23 #global #world #temperature #salinity #dissolvedoxygen #inorganicnutrients #inorganic #nutrients #WorldOceanDatabase #WOD #opendata #opendatagateway #oceangraphy #climatologies #climate #depth #sampling #remotesensing #hydrospatial #Nitrate #Phosphate #Silicate #statistics #geostatistics
@NOAA @NOAA_NCEI -
World Ocean Atlas 2023 - Global Climatologies of Temperature, Salinity, Dissolved Oxygen, and Inorganic Nutrients
--
https://www.ncei.noaa.gov/news/World-Ocean-Atlas-2023-v2 <-- shared technical article
--
#GIS #spatial #mapping #NOAA #NCEI #water #hydrology #hydrography #OceanClimateLaboratory #OCL #WorldOceanAtlas #WOA #WOA23 #global #world #temperature #salinity #dissolvedoxygen #inorganicnutrients #inorganic #nutrients #WorldOceanDatabase #WOD #opendata #opendatagateway #oceangraphy #climatologies #climate #depth #sampling #remotesensing #hydrospatial #Nitrate #Phosphate #Silicate #statistics #geostatistics
@NOAA @NOAA_NCEI -
🎂 🎂 Today is my 1st #LISTAnniversary 🎉 🎉
One year ago, I started alone building the next generation of #intelligent #lowcode #platforms for #smart #software systems as part of the #BESSER project.
Given my limited programming skills 😅, it's good that now we're a team of 12 pushing this goal. Expect a major release of the main #lowcode platform very soon with #OCL support, #UI modeling, #REST #API generation ... 👀👀
And as always 💯 #opensource #openaccess #openscience
-
Having already tooted , I’ve decided I need to pay more attention to #Hastags . So here# we go with #introduction . I’m an #eyfs teacher now an #eyfstooters and interested in #childdevelopment #childrensbooks and #outdoorplay . I enjoy #reading and #history and have many connections with the #equine world . Any teachers from #OCL here? I have strong opinions about many things but am always willing to listen to different views .
-
Having already tooted , I’ve decided I need to pay more attention to #Hastags . So here# we go with #introduction . I’m an #eyfs teacher now an #eyfstooters and interested in #childdevelopment #childrensbooks and #outdoorplay . I enjoy #reading and #history and have many connections with the #equine world . Any teachers from #OCL here? I have strong opinions about many things but am always willing to listen to different views .
-
Hey there everyone...we're back from the Oversubscribed Cloud Limbo
#OCL
(it's dorky, but the best that I can come up with on a Thursday)